What is Bitcoin Mining?
Bitcoin mining is the process of validating and adding new transactions to the blockchain, which is the public ledger of all Bitcoin transactions. Miners use their computers to solve complex mathematical problems, and when they solve these problems, they are rewarded with Bitcoin. This process ensures the security and integrity of the Bitcoin network.
The process of mining involves several steps. First, miners download the Bitcoin blockchain and a copy of the Bitcoin software. Then, they set up their mining rig, which is a computer equipped with powerful graphics processing units (GPUs) or application-specific integrated circuits (ASICs). These rigs are designed to solve the mathematical problems required for mining.
What is a Bitcoin Mining App?
A bitcoin mining app is a software program that allows users to mine Bitcoin on their computers or mobile devices. These apps simplify the mining process by automating various tasks, such as monitoring the mining rig's performance, adjusting the mining parameters, and connecting to mining pools.
There are several types of bitcoin mining apps available, each with its unique features and capabilities. Some of the popular mining apps include:
1. CGMiner: This is a popular open-source mining app that supports various c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in. It is known for its efficiency and flexibility.
2. BFGMiner: Another open-source mining app, BFGMiner, is designed for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ies. It offers advanced features, such as monitoring and control over the mining rig's performance.
3. EasyMiner: This is a user-friendly mining app that is suitable for beginners. It supports various cryptocurrencies and offers a simple interface for monitoring and managing the mining process.
4. MultiMiner: This app allows users to mine multiple cryptocurrencies simultaneously. It supports various mining hardware and offers an easy-to-use interface.
How Does a Bitcoin Mining App Work?
When you download a bitcoin mining app, you can install it on your computer or mobile device. Once installed, the app will connect you to a mining pool, which is a group of miners working together to solve the mathematical problems required for mining.
The app will then start mining Bitcoin on your behalf. It will use your computer's processing power to solve the mathematical problems, and when it successfully solves a problem, you will receive a share of the Bitcoin reward.
However, it's important to note that mining Bitcoin can be a resource-intensive process. Your computer's GPU or ASIC will generate heat, consume electricity, and produce noise. Therefore, it's crucial to ensure that your mining rig is properly cooled and that you have a reliable power supply.
